
If you like one of those who frequently use your mobile phone for taking photos, things just got a little clearer. Samsung recently unveiled what they claim is the world’s thinnest 8MP CMOS designed for use with cellphones.
The device measures just 28mm × 15.3mm × 8.5mm, and the small size is not all. Like many digital cameras, the little photo-taking module features face-detection, anti-shake, ISO 1600 sensitivity and can even detect and automatically snap a photo when it recognizes a smile.
Fortunately this isn’t just some hyped technology that Samsung is flaunting for years down the road. The company says the new slim 8MP CMOS should be available for mobile phones yet in the 3rd or 4th quarter of this year.
